
I like this: Midnight Shine
If you think you have trouble getting everyone in your band together rehearse, think what the guys in Midnight Shine have to do. The members are scattered over remote parts of Northern Ontario near James Bay.
The band is ready to release their third album, High Road, on February 23. John-Angus McDonald of The Trews produced seven songs for the record with Tim Vesley of the Rheostatics taking care of the other two.
To prep everyone for the album is this version of Neil Young’s “Heart of Gold” with Chris Gormley of Big Sugar on Drums.
